Skip to content
Snippets Groups Projects

SSDM-13578 : 2PT : Database and V3 Implementation - include the new AFS "free"...

Closed Artur Pedziwilk requested to merge RP-3782-add-docker-desktop-quickstart into 20.10.x
5 files
+ 22
10
Compare changes
  • Side-by-side
  • Inline
Files
5
@@ -15,6 +15,9 @@
*/
package ch.ethz.sis.openbis.generic.server.asapi.v3.executor.material;
import ch.ethz.sis.openbis.generic.asapi.v3.dto.common.id.IObjectId;
import ch.ethz.sis.openbis.generic.asapi.v3.dto.entitytype.id.EntityTypePermId;
import ch.systemsx.cisd.openbis.generic.shared.dto.ExperimentTypePE;
import org.springframework.beans.factory.annotation.Autowired;
import org.springframework.stereotype.Component;
@@ -78,7 +81,18 @@ public class CreateMaterialTypesExecutor extends AbstractCreateEntityTypeExecuto
@Override
protected void checkAccess(IOperationContext context)
{
authorizationExecutor.canCreate(context);
}
@Override
protected void checkAccess(IOperationContext context, MaterialTypePE materialTypePE)
{
authorizationExecutor.canCreate(context, materialTypePE);
}
@Override
protected IObjectId getId(MaterialTypePE materialTypePE)
{
return new EntityTypePermId(materialTypePE.getPermId());
}
}
Loading